Coconut water ??                    

Coconut water is the clear liquid found inside immature coconuts. As the coconut matures, the water is replaced by coconut meat. Coconut water sometimes referred to as green coconut water because the immature coconuts are green in colour.

Coconut water is naturally refreshing, has a sweet, nutty taste. It contains easily digested carbohydrates in the form of sugar and electrolytes

Benefits of coconut water 


(1) Good source of nutrients 

Coconut water is the juice found in the center of a young, green coconut. It helps nourish the fruit.  

Coconut water forms naturally in the fruit and contains 94% water and very little fat.


(2)Excellent source of hydration 

Coconut water is slightly sweet with a subtle, nutty flavor. It’s also fairly low in calories and carbs.

This tropical liquid can be used in smoothies, vinaigrette dressing or substituted for plain water whenever you want a bit of natural sweetness.

(3) May have antioxidant properties 

In addition to all of its hydrating benefits, coconut water contains antioxidant that help to neutralize oxidative stress and free radicals created by exercise. Look for fresh coconut water to get the highest levels of antioxidants. Processed and heat pasteurized coconut water has fewer antioxidants, according to a recent study.
